Authorship and Creation
The Left Handed Gun's producer is recorded as Fred Coe[26]. Its director is recorded as Arthur Penn[4]. Its screenwriter is recorded as Leslie Stevens[5]. Cast members include Paul Newman[9], Hurd Hatfield[10], James Best[11], John Dehner[12], John Dierkes[13], and Denver Pyle[14].
Publication
The Left Handed Gun's publication date is recorded as +1958-01-01T00:00:00Z[28]. Its original language of film or TV show is recorded as English[29]. Genres include biographical film[7] and Western film[8].
